Help recovering data from hard drive
Hi people,
Im hoping you can help me. My friend recently had his laptop die on him due to a virus, he has asked me to recover as much of his information (media, documents etc) from it as possible using my hard drive docking bay. I've hit a problem though, every time I click on a folder or try to copy it it says I do not have the right permissions and it can not be done, I assume this is due to him having to log into windows (when it worked) on his old machine. Any idea on how to remove or disable this? so I can recover his data? Thanks ;) |
Re: Help recovering data from hard drive
Select the folder, choose properties, security, advanced and change the Owners permissions for your current user to FULL CONTROL.. It might take a few minutes if you're doing a lot of files but after that you should have full access
